상세 컨텐츠

본문 제목

[IntelliJ][Git] 인텔리제이에서 깃 연동하기

캡스톤

by 정혜리 2021. 2. 23. 01:53

본문

나는 시작할 프로젝트 파일을 만들지 않고 조장님이 만들어둔 파일을 바로 가져올거다 !

 

1. 깃 확인

File > Settings... 클릭해서 Settings 창을 연다

 

Version Control 을 눌러 Git 을 클릭한다

 

test 를 클릭해 깃이 정상적인지 확인한다

 

2. 깃 계정 추가

 

아까  Settings > Version Control > Git 밑에 있는 GitHub를 클릭해서 연다 

Add Account... 클릭

그러면 이 페이지가 켜지는데 Authorize in GitHub 를 클릭해 승인을 진행한다

 

난 바로 이렇게 성공메세지가 떴다

인텔리제이로 돌아가보면 

내 계정이 잘 추가된 것을 확인할 수 있다

 

3. 깃 클론

 

이제 깃 클론을 해보자 !

먼저 추가할 깃허브 주소로 가서 URL을 복사해온다

 

 

인텔리제이로 돌아와서

Get from VCS 클릭

 

그럼 아래와 같은 창이 뜨는데 URL에다가 아까 복사한 주소를 입력한다

디렉토리는 자동으로 프로젝트 이름과 동일하게 생성된다

CLONE 누르면 끝 !

 

4. 커밋 제외 파일 관리하기

 

깃에서 특정 파일을 커밋 대상에서 제외할 때 .gitignore 파일을 사용한다

여기에 커밋대상에서 제외할 파일(인텔리제이에서 자동으로 생성되는 파일)들을 적어준다

 

인텔리제이에서는 ignore 플러그인을 다운받아야하므로 marketplace에서 .ignore 를 다운받고 재시작한다 !

 

ctrl + shift + a 에서 plugins 를 쳐서 MarketPlace 로 이동

검색창에 ignore 를 입력해 아래 사진과 같은 플러그인을 다운받는다

다 다운받았으면 인텔리제이에 적용하기 위해 꼭 재시작을 해준다 !

 

인텔리제이를 새로 시작했으면 ignore 파일을 추가해보자

프로젝트 우클릭 > New > ignore file > .gitignore File (Git) 클릭

 

 

이렇게 Generator 창이 뜨는데 새로 만들어 사용할거라서 Generate 를 클릭해 .gitignore파일을 생성한다

 

 

추가하지 않을 파일을 모두 이그노어 처리한다

 

이제 이걸 깃허브에 반영해보자

 

5. 깃 커밋 + 푸시

 

먼저 깃 커밋창을 연다

ctrl + K

 

커밋할 파일을 선택하고 commit 버튼을 누르면 된다

 

이제 바로 푸시도 해보면

 

푸시 단축키 : ctrl + shift + k

 

그럼 푸시화면이 나오는데 push 버튼을 클릭하면 바로 푸시 된다 !

 

깃허브 프로젝트 주소로 가보면 푸시한 것을 확인할 수 있다 !!

 

연동 끝~~

'캡스톤' 카테고리의 다른 글

[spring] 메일 전송 구현  (0) 2021.04.06
[spring] JPQL(Java Persistence Query Language)  (0) 2021.04.06
[Git] 깃 환경  (0) 2021.01.20
[Git] 깃 설정하기  (0) 2021.01.20
[Git] 깃 설치  (0) 2021.01.19

관련글 더보기